LC Waikiki brand enters to Croatian market

16 April 2019

The Turkish based retailer is coming to Croatia, with plans to open its first store in Arena Center in Zagreb in mid-May. The company began its search for new employees at the beginning of the year ahead of its decision to set up stores in the capital as well as in Split. LC Waikiki is owned by the Turkish Kucuk and Dizdar families. Mustafa Kucuk is the largest individual shareholder worth $1.1 billion. The company was established in 1988 by the French designer Georges Amouyal with partners LC-Les Copains, becoming LC Waikiki Magazacilik Hizmetleri Ticaret in 1997. LC Waikiki already operates stores in Bosnia and Serbia as well as 43 other countries.
